Good Springs PU was named ‘Excellent Job Creator 2010’ by the Ministry of Employment and Labor. Good Springs PU hired over 170 new employees, which accounts for 33 percent of its manpower as of September 2009. 167 of them are regular employees and it hired outstanding graduates of local colleges, thereby contributing to the revitalization of the local labor market and the qualitative growth of employment figures. To aggressively enter the global pump market, Good Springs PU, which has grown rapidly in recent years, hired foreign professional manpower in the United States, India and Uzbekistan and has actively tried to attract outstanding Koreans living overseas through meetings with overseas Korean students, including the Korean-American Scientists and Engineers Association. Also, in the fresh water field, where technological R&D initiatives are actively engaged, such as the ‘renewable fresh water plant,’ it hired new employees in the R&D and technology sector to work on new projects. Recently Good Springs PU successfully built the ‘renewable fresh water plant,’ as part of the SMART project of the Ministry of Knowledge and Economy and became the first to develop Containerized RO.
